What are Safety Interlock Devices?
Safety interlock devices are basically gadgets that are installed on the Scraper Feeder Chain system to prevent dangerous situations. They work by making sure that certain conditions are met before the chain can operate or continue to run. Types of Safety Interlock Devices
1. Limit Switches
Limit switches are one of the most common safety interlock devices. They are usually placed at specific points along the Scraper Feeder Chain’s path. When the chain reaches a certain position, it trips the limit switch. For example, at the end of the chain’s travel path, a limit switch can be installed. Once the chain gets there, the switch stops the motor, preventing the chain from going any further and potentially causing damage to the equipment or even an accident.
These switches are pretty reliable and easy to install. They come in different types, like mechanical and proximity limit switches. Mechanical limit switches have a physical contact that gets triggered when the chain hits it, while proximity limit switches use magnetic or inductive sensors to detect the presence of the chain without any physical contact.
2. Speed Sensors
Speed sensors are crucial for keeping an eye on how fast the Scraper Feeder Chain is moving. If the chain starts to run too fast or too slow, it could be a sign of a problem. For instance, if the chain is running too fast, it might put extra stress on the components, leading to premature wear and tear or even a chain breakage. On the other hand, if it’s running too slow, it might not be able to feed the material properly.
Speed sensors work by measuring the rotational speed of the chain’s drive sprocket or other moving parts. They send this information to a control system. If the speed is outside the normal range, the control system can stop the chain or adjust its speed accordingly.
3. Tension Sensors
Maintaining the right tension in the Scraper Feeder Chain is essential for its smooth operation. Tension sensors are used to monitor the tension of the chain. If the tension is too high, it can cause excessive wear on the chain and the sprockets. If it’s too low, the chain might slip, leading to inefficient feeding or even a complete stoppage.
Tension sensors can be mechanical or electronic. Mechanical sensors use springs or other mechanical components to measure the tension, while electronic sensors use strain gauges or load cells. When the tension goes out of the acceptable range, the sensor sends a signal to the control system, which can then take appropriate action, like adjusting the tensioning device.
4. Emergency Stop Buttons
Emergency stop buttons are a simple but very important safety interlock device. They are usually placed at easily accessible locations around the Scraper Feeder Chain system. In case of an emergency, like a chain breakage, a jam, or a worker getting too close to the moving parts, anyone can press the emergency stop button. This immediately cuts off the power to the motor, stopping the chain in its tracks and preventing further damage or injury.
Why are Safety Interlock Devices Important?
Protecting Workers
The most obvious reason is to protect the workers. In industries where Scraper Feeder Chains are used, there are many potential hazards. Workers can get caught in the moving chain, be hit by flying debris if the chain breaks, or suffer from other accidents due to improper operation of the chain. Safety interlock devices help to reduce these risks by stopping the chain when dangerous conditions occur.
Preventing Equipment Damage
Safety interlock devices also help to prevent damage to the Scraper Feeder Chain itself and other related equipment. By stopping the chain when there are problems like over – speed, excessive tension, or a chain reaching its limit, these devices can save companies a lot of money on repairs and replacements.
Ensuring Smooth Operation
Properly functioning safety interlock devices ensure that the Scraper Feeder Chain operates smoothly. They help to maintain the chain’s speed, tension, and position within the acceptable range, which means better performance and less downtime.
